A Comprehensive Guide To EPS Expandable Polystyrene

EPS expandable polystyrene, commonly referred to as EPS, is a versatile and widely used material in the packaging and construction industries With its lightweight, durable, and insulating properties, EPS has become a popular choice for a variety of applications In this article, we will explore the characteristics, uses, and benefits of EPS expandable polystyrene.

EPS is a type of thermoplastic that is made from the polymerization of styrene monomer The expandable form of polystyrene is created by suspending tiny beads of polystyrene in a blowing agent, such as pentane When subjected to heat, the blowing agent expands the beads, creating a lightweight foam material with a closed-cell structure This results in a material that is rigid, yet flexible, with excellent thermal insulation properties.

One of the key characteristics of EPS expandable polystyrene is its lightweight nature This makes it an ideal material for packaging applications, as it can provide cushioning and protection for fragile items without adding significant weight EPS is also resistant to moisture, making it suitable for use in environments where exposure to water or humidity is a concern.

In the construction industry, EPS is commonly used as insulation material for buildings Its thermal properties help to regulate indoor temperatures, reducing the need for heating and cooling systems Additionally, EPS is non-toxic, inert, and resistant to mold and mildew growth, making it a safe and environmentally friendly option for insulation.

Its lightweight and insulating properties make it an excellent choice for keeping hot foods hot and cold foods cold EPS packaging is also cost-effective and easily disposable, making it a popular option for food service businesses.

Another common application of EPS is in the production of protective packaging for electronics, appliances, and other sensitive items EPS packaging inserts can be customized to fit the specific dimensions of the product, providing a secure cushion that absorbs shock and prevents damage during shipping and handling.

One of the key benefits of EPS expandable polystyrene is its recyclability While EPS is a durable material that can last for many years, it is also fully recyclable and can be reused in the production of new foam products Many recycling facilities accept EPS foam for recycling, helping to reduce the amount of waste that ends up in landfills.

However, it is important to note that not all recycling facilities accept EPS foam for recycling, as it can be challenging to process due to its lightweight and bulky nature To address this issue, some companies have developed innovative recycling solutions, such as compacting or densifying EPS foam into more manageable forms for recycling.

In addition to its recyclability, EPS expandable polystyrene is also energy-efficient to produce The manufacturing process for EPS foam requires less energy compared to other packaging materials, making it a more sustainable option for businesses looking to reduce their carbon footprint.
